Beef and Biscuit Casserole

1 to 1 1/4 lbs. ground beef
1/2 cup onion, chopped or 2 Tablespoons instant mince onion
1/2 cup green pepper, diced
1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ce
2 Tablespoons chili powder
1/2 teaspoon garlic salt
1 (8 ounce) can buttermilk biscuits
1 1/2 cup shredded Monterey Jack or Cheddar cheese, divided use
1/2 cup sour cream
1 egg, slightly beaten

Preheat oven to 375 degrees F.

Brown beef, onion and green pepper in large frying pan;drain. Stir in tomato sauce, chili powder and garlic salt. Simmer while preparing dough.

Separate biscuit dough into 10 biscuits. Pull each apart into 2 layers. Press half of the layers over the bottom of an ungreased 8- or 9-inch square baking pan.

Combine 1/2 cup cheese, sour cream and egg. Mix well.

Remove meat mixture from heat. Stir in sour cream mixture. Spoon over dough in pan. Arrange remaining biscuit layers on top. Sprinkle with remaining cheese.

Bake for 25 to 30 minutes or until biscuits are a deep golden brown.
